Meet the Legends: Nat Bates and Willie Reed to Appear at Saskatchewan Sports Hall of Fame on June 11
Regina, SK – May 1, 2025 – The Saskatchewan Sports Hall of Fame, in partnership with the Saskatchewan African Canadian Heritage Museum (SACHM) and the Indian Head Museum (IHM), is honoured to host a special Meet and Greet event with Nat Bates and Willie Reed, two original members of the groundbreaking Indian Head Rockets baseball team. This public event will take place on Wednesday, June 11th from 11:00 a.m. to 1:00 p.m. at the Saskatchewan Sports Hall of Fame, located in downtown Regina.
The Indian Head Rockets, an African American and Latino baseball team, played and barnstormed across Saskatchewan and Alberta in the early 1950s, challenging racial barriers and elevating the level of play across the prairies. In 1952, Bates, Reed, and three friends from Richmond, California, joined the team, bringing speed, power, and extraordinary skill to every game. Now in their 90s, Nat and Willie return to Saskatchewan as living legends to share their stories and connect with the community that welcomed them decades ago.
